Output 27d8c70e1b8142068129c9cef837bca84151afb5257717fd4b536390452be5f0:0

value
314130
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ac353d0b2534d19b6627e777993d1641a292dbc OP_EQUAL
address
3BRXYTr4ziYUqSsDgvJJSSpkGcLuYVHbwX
transaction
27d8c70e1b8142068129c9cef837bca84151afb5257717fd4b536390452be5f0
confirmations
266004
spent
true